What Causes Sheetrock to Crack? DIY Fix Guide
Sheetrock, also known as drywall, is a common wall finish, but its rigid nature means it is not immune to cracking. Many homeowners wonder what causes sheetrock to crack, often discovering unsightly lines snaking across their walls or ceilings. One major culprit is structural movement, where the house itself shifts due to settling or changes in the foundation. Environmental factors also play a role, as fluctuations in humidity can cause the wood framing behind the drywall to expand and contract, stressing the sheetrock. Another frequent issue arises during the initial installation if the drywall contractor does not properly tape and mud the seams, which creates weak points susceptible to cracking. Finally, everyday impacts like slamming doors or heavy objects bumping against the wall can contribute to these fractures over time.

The Usual Suspects: Causes of Sheetrock Damage
Sheetrock damage isn't random. It's usually a symptom of an underlying issue. Here's a breakdown of the most common causes:
Settling: The Natural Shift
Houses, especially new ones, settle over time. This natural movement can cause minor cracks, particularly around corners of windows and doors.
Think of it as the house adjusting to its foundations. These cracks are usually hairline and more of a cosmetic nuisance than a structural problem.
Foundation Issues: A Deeper Concern
More serious cracks, especially diagonal cracks running from the corners of doors or windows, could indicate foundation problems.
Other signs include sticking doors and windows, sloping floors, and cracks in the foundation itself. If you suspect foundation issues, consult a structural engineer ASAP.
Moisture/Humidity: The Silent Destroyer
Water is sheetrock's worst enemy. Leaks, high humidity, or even condensation can weaken the material, leading to sagging, bubbling, and mold growth.
Pay close attention to areas around bathrooms, kitchens, and basements. Address any leaks immediately to prevent further damage.
Temperature Fluctuations: Expansion and Contraction
Sheetrock expands and contracts with temperature changes. This can cause stress, leading to hairline cracks, especially in areas with extreme temperature swings.
Good insulation can help minimize these fluctuations.
Improper Installation: Shortcuts That Backfire
Sometimes, the problem lies in the initial installation. Using the wrong type of screws, insufficient support, or poorly taped seams can all lead to problems down the road.
Unfortunately, this often requires more extensive repairs.
Poor Framing: A Lack of Support
The sheetrock is only as good as the framing behind it. Inadequate or unstable framing can cause movement and cracking, especially in walls that bear a lot of weight.
Again, this may require professional assessment and repair.
Impact Damage: Dents, Holes, and More
This one's pretty straightforward. Accidents happen. Furniture, doorknobs, and even overzealous hammering can leave dents, holes, and other forms of physical damage.
These are usually easy to spot and relatively simple to repair.
Stress Cracks: Signs of Strain
Stress cracks often appear around doors and windows, especially in high-traffic areas. They're caused by the repeated opening and closing of doors or windows, which puts stress on the surrounding sheetrock.
Nail Pops/Screw Pops: The Annoying Imperfections
These little bumps occur when nails or screws work their way out of the studs behind the sheetrock. This can be caused by settling, humidity changes, or simply poor installation.
They're usually easy to fix, but can be a sign of a larger issue if they're widespread.
Decoding the Cracks: Hairline vs. Larger
Not all cracks are created equal. Hairline cracks are typically thin and superficial, often caused by settling or temperature fluctuations. Larger cracks, especially those wider than 1/8 inch, can indicate more serious structural problems.
Pay attention to the size, shape, and location of the cracks to help you determine the underlying cause.

Must-Have Materials for Sheetrock Repair
The quality of your materials directly impacts the final result, so don't skimp on the essentials. Here's a breakdown of the core ingredients for a successful repair:
Sheetrock: Choosing the Right Size and Thickness
For patching, you'll ideally want sheetrock that matches the existing thickness of your walls or ceilings (typically 1/2" or 5/8"). Smaller pieces for patching are readily available, saving you from buying a full sheet.
Joint Compound (Mud): Navigating the Options
Joint compound, or "mud," is the key to concealing seams and imperfections. Here's a quick guide:
-
All-Purpose: A good starting point for most repairs. It's versatile but can shrink a bit as it dries.
-
Lightweight: Easier to sand and work with, which is ideal for beginners. It's less prone to shrinking but may not be as durable as all-purpose.
-
Setting-Type (Chemical Hardening): This type dries quickly through a chemical reaction and is incredibly durable. It's great for filling larger gaps or holes where shrinkage is a concern. However, it's less forgiving to sand and requires more experience.
Drywall Tape: Paper vs. Mesh
Drywall tape reinforces joints and prevents cracking. You have two main choices:
-
Paper Tape: Stronger and creates a smoother finish. Requires embedding in a thin layer of joint compound. The professional's choice for its durability.
-
Mesh Tape (Fiberglass): Self-adhesive and easier to apply, especially for beginners. It's more prone to cracking if not properly embedded in multiple layers of joint compound. Best for smaller repairs and those new to drywall work.
Drywall Screws: Selecting the Right Size
Use drywall screws specifically designed for sheetrock. Their bugle head prevents them from tearing the paper.
Choose a length that penetrates the stud by at least 1 inch. 1 1/4" screws are common for 1/2" sheetrock.
Patching Compound (Spackle): For Minor Imperfections
Spackle is your go-to for small holes, nail pops, and minor dings. It's pre-mixed, easy to apply, and sands smoothly.
Primer: Preparing for a Flawless Finish
Priming is essential for sealing the repaired area and ensuring the paint adheres properly.
Use a drywall primer specifically designed for porous surfaces. This will help create a uniform finish and prevent the paint from being absorbed unevenly.
Paint: Achieving a Seamless Blend
To achieve a truly invisible repair, use the exact same paint that's already on your walls. If you don't have any leftover paint, take a small chip to your local paint store for color matching. Don't forget to match the sheen as well (matte, eggshell, satin, etc.).
Caulk (Paintable Caulk): Sealing Gaps for a Professional Look
Use paintable caulk to seal any gaps around trim, windows, or doors after completing your sheetrock repairs. This will create a clean, professional finish and prevent drafts.
Essential Tools for Sheetrock Mastery
With the right materials in hand, you'll need the tools to apply them effectively. Here's a rundown of the essential tools for your sheetrock repair kit:
Utility Knife (Drywall Knife): Precision Cutting
A sharp utility knife is indispensable for scoring and cutting sheetrock. A dull blade will tear the paper, creating a ragged edge. Change blades frequently for clean, accurate cuts.
Taping Knives: Smoothing Things Over
Taping knives are used to apply and smooth joint compound. You'll want a variety of sizes:
-
A smaller 4-6 inch knife for initial taping and tight spaces.
-
A larger 10-12 inch knife for feathering the edges and creating a smooth, seamless finish.
Sanding Sponge/Block: Achieving Perfection
After the joint compound dries, you'll need to sand it smooth. A sanding sponge or block with medium-grit sandpaper is ideal for this. Avoid using power sanders, as they can easily damage the surrounding wall.
Mud Pan/Hawk: Efficient Application
A mud pan or hawk is used to hold joint compound while you're applying it. This allows you to work more efficiently and keep your knife clean.
Level: Ensuring Even Surfaces
A level is crucial for ensuring your patch is flush with the surrounding wall. Use it to check for any unevenness before applying the final coat of joint compound.
Stud Finder: Securing Your Patch
When patching a hole, you'll need to secure the patch to something solid. A stud finder helps you locate the studs behind the wall, so you can screw the patch in place.

Fixing Hairline Cracks: A Delicate Touch
Hairline cracks might seem insignificant, but they can be an eyesore. Addressing them promptly prevents them from worsening over time. Here’s how to make those tiny cracks disappear:
-
Prep the area: Cleaning and lightly sanding the surface.
Start by cleaning the area around the crack with a damp cloth to remove any dust or debris.
Lightly sand the surface with fine-grit sandpaper to create a smooth base for the joint compound.
This helps the compound adhere better.
-
Applying Joint Compound: Using thin coats and feathering edges.
Apply a thin coat of joint compound over the crack using a taping knife.
Feather the edges by applying less pressure as you move away from the crack.
This creates a smooth transition between the patched area and the existing wall.
Let it dry completely (refer to the compound's instructions for drying times).
-
Sanding Smooth: Achieving a Seamless Finish.
Once the joint compound is dry, use a sanding sponge or block to carefully sand the area smooth.
Be gentle to avoid damaging the surrounding wall.
Wipe away any sanding dust with a clean, damp cloth.
-
Priming and Painting: Matching the Existing Wall Color and Texture.
Apply a coat of primer to the repaired area to seal the joint compound.
This ensures that the paint adheres properly.
Once the primer is dry, paint the area with a color that matches the existing wall.
You might need multiple coats for complete coverage.
Repairing Larger Cracks: Reinforcing for Longevity
Larger cracks require more attention to ensure structural integrity and prevent future issues. Here’s the step-by-step:
-
Widening the Crack: Creating a Clean V-Shaped Groove.
Use a utility knife to carefully widen the crack, creating a clean, V-shaped groove.
This allows the joint compound to penetrate deeper and creates a stronger bond.
Remove any loose debris from the crack.
-
Applying Mesh Tape: Centering the Tape Over the Crack.
Apply fiberglass mesh tape over the crack.
Ensure it is centered.
The mesh tape provides reinforcement and prevents the crack from reappearing.
-
Mudding: Applying Multiple Coats of Joint Compound, Allowing Each Coat to Dry.
Apply a thin coat of joint compound over the mesh tape, using a taping knife.
Let it dry completely.
Apply a second and third coat, feathering the edges each time.
Allow each coat to dry before applying the next.
-
Sanding and Finishing: Blending the Repair Seamlessly with the Surrounding Wall.
Once the final coat of joint compound is dry, sand the area smooth using a sanding sponge or block.
Prime the repaired area.
Paint to match the surrounding wall for a seamless finish.
Patching Holes: Restoring Structural Integrity
Whether it’s from a doorknob or an accident, holes in sheetrock require a patch for a proper fix. Here's how to do it:
-
Cutting Out the Damaged Area: Creating a Square or Rectangular Opening.
Use a utility knife to cut out the damaged area, creating a square or rectangular opening.
Make sure the opening is large enough to expose the edges of the surrounding sheetrock.
This creates a clean surface for the patch.
-
Fitting a Sheetrock Patch: Securing the Patch to the Studs or with Furring Strips.
Cut a piece of sheetrock that is slightly larger than the opening.
If the opening doesn’t align with studs, attach furring strips to the inside of the wall.
Screw the patch to the furring strips.
The furring strips provide a secure backing for the patch.
-
Taping and Mudding: Applying Drywall Tape and Multiple Coats of Joint Compound.
Apply drywall tape around the edges of the patch, covering the seams.
Apply a thin coat of joint compound over the tape.
Let it dry.
Apply multiple coats of joint compound, feathering the edges each time.
Allow each coat to dry before applying the next.
-
Sanding, Priming, and Painting: Finishing the Patch to Match the Surrounding Wall.
Once the final coat of joint compound is dry, sand the area smooth.
Prime the repaired area.
Paint it to match the surrounding wall.
Dealing with Nail Pops/Screw Pops: A Quick Fix
Nail pops or screw pops are common, especially in newer homes as they settle. Luckily, they are an easy fix!
-
Resetting the Fastener: Driving the Nail or Screw Back In Slightly Deeper.
Use a hammer and nail set (for nails) or a screwdriver (for screws) to gently drive the nail or screw back into the wall.
Be careful not to break the paper face of the sheetrock.
If the fastener is damaged, replace it with a new one.
-
Applying Joint Compound: Covering the Imperfection with a Thin Layer.
Apply a thin coat of joint compound over the recessed nail or screw, covering the imperfection.
Feather the edges to blend with the surrounding surface.
Let it dry completely.
-
Sanding and Finishing: Blending the Repaired Area with the Surrounding Surface.
Once the joint compound is dry, lightly sand the area smooth with a sanding sponge.
Prime the spot.
Paint it to match the surrounding wall.

Moisture Control: Your First Line of Defense
Moisture is enemy number one when it comes to sheetrock. Excessive humidity or water leaks can lead to warping, staining, and even mold growth. Maintaining proper moisture levels is critical to preventing these issues.
Addressing Leaks Promptly
This might seem obvious, but it's worth emphasizing. Any leaks, whether from plumbing, roofing, or windows, should be addressed immediately.
Even small, seemingly insignificant leaks can cause significant damage over time. Don’t delay repairs!
The Power of Dehumidifiers and Ventilation
In humid climates or areas prone to moisture buildup (like bathrooms and basements), dehumidifiers can be a lifesaver. They help draw excess moisture out of the air, preventing it from seeping into your walls.
Proper ventilation is equally important. Ensure your bathrooms and kitchens have working exhaust fans to vent out moisture-laden air.

Identifying Structural Issues: More Than Just a Crack
Sometimes, a crack in your sheetrock isn't just a cosmetic issue; it's a symptom of a larger structural problem. Recognizing these signs is crucial for maintaining the integrity of your home.
Horizontal or vertical cracks spanning long distances, especially near windows or doors, can indicate foundation settlement or other structural movement. These cracks often widen over time.
Stair-step cracks in the foundation are another telltale sign of potential problems. While small hairline cracks are often not cause for alarm, large or numerous cracks may indicate an issue.
Uneven floors, doors that stick, or windows that are difficult to open or close can be subtle indicators of underlying structural problems affecting your sheetrock. These issues often manifest alongside wall and ceiling cracks.
If you notice any of these signs, it's best to consult with a structural engineer or foundation specialist. They can assess the extent of the damage and recommend the appropriate repairs. Ignoring these warnings can lead to more significant and costly problems down the road.
Extensive Damage: When DIY Becomes Overwhelming
Small holes and minor cracks are manageable for most DIYers. But when you're facing extensive damage, such as water-damaged sheetrock, large holes, or significant areas of cracking, it may be time to call in a professional.
Dealing with large areas of damaged sheetrock requires specialized tools, expertise, and time. Professionals have the experience to efficiently and effectively repair or replace large sections of sheetrock. This can ensure the repairs are done correctly and meet building codes.
Complex repairs, such as those involving textured walls or ceilings, often require specialized skills. Matching existing textures and ensuring a seamless blend is challenging for even experienced DIYers.
If you find yourself feeling overwhelmed or unsure about how to proceed, it's a sign that professional help may be necessary. Attempting to tackle a project that's beyond your capabilities can lead to frustration and potentially exacerbate the problem.
Mold and Mildew: A Serious Health Hazard
Mold and mildew growth on sheetrock is a serious issue that requires immediate attention. Mold can cause respiratory problems, allergies, and other health issues, making it essential to address it properly.
If you suspect mold growth, do not attempt to clean it yourself. Disturbing mold can release spores into the air. That can worsen the problem and potentially expose you and your family to harmful toxins.
Professional mold remediation services have the necessary equipment and expertise to safely remove mold and address the underlying moisture issues that caused it. They can also ensure that the mold doesn't return.
If you're unsure whether you have mold, consulting a professional mold inspector is a good idea. They can perform tests to identify the type of mold and recommend the appropriate remediation steps.

FAQs: Understanding Sheetrock Cracks
Why are hairline cracks often seen above doors and windows?
Hairline cracks frequently appear above doors and windows because these are stress points in the house's structure. Movement from settling, temperature changes, or even just the opening and closing of doors can put pressure on the surrounding sheetrock. This constant stress is a common reason for what causes sheetrock to crack in these locations.
Is a crack in my ceiling always a sign of a major structural problem?
Not always. While significant ceiling cracks could indicate a serious issue like foundation problems, many are simply cosmetic. Small, stable cracks are often the result of normal settling or temperature/humidity fluctuations, which can cause the wood framing to expand and contract. It is important to investigate and monitor what causes sheetrock to crack to rule out larger issues.
Can humidity affect sheetrock and cause it to crack?
Yes, humidity plays a significant role. High humidity levels can cause sheetrock to expand, and when it dries out, it contracts. This constant expansion and contraction cycle puts stress on the sheetrock, particularly at seams and corners. Knowing what causes sheetrock to crack in humid environments is crucial for preventative maintenance.
If I fix a crack in my sheetrock, how can I prevent it from reappearing?
Prevention depends on understanding the underlying cause. Addressing the source of the problem, such as improving insulation to minimize temperature fluctuations or fixing a leaky roof, is essential. Using flexible joint compound and reinforcing tape during repairs can also help accommodate minor movements and prevent what causes sheetrock to crack again in the same spot.
